What Is It?
Self storage means leasing a warehouse to a customer or tenant. People who owe and operate a storage unit rent it on monthly or quarterly basis depending on the need of the customer.
What Do Storage Warehouses Offer?
Tenants use these spaces for storing household goods, cars, boats, and anything they can think of. These are used for storing not only household goods, but also business goods. Usually, customers prefer to secure their lockers or units themselves. Self storage operator's offer limited access to the units or locker owned by the customer. A good warehouse must be equipped with barred wires, computerized vigilance, hidden cameras, alarm doors, unit lights, etc. to ensure 100 percent safety of the clients' belongings. Security guards are also imperative. If you are planning to hire a storage facility, make sure the warehouse provides all necessary facilities.
Types
Today, you can find storage facilities catering to the needs of different customers. The following are three common types of warehouses:
*Boat And Yacht Storage: Most warehouses in the United States provide boat and yacht storage facilities. With a number of people owning a boat or a yacht, storage units have come up with the idea of storing such type of items. An individual can hire an open, covered, or closed space to keep their boats properly. In fact, some warehouses provide special climate controlled units to serve the specific needs of their customers.
*Car And RV Storage: Car and RV storage is very much in demand these days. If you have more than one car but don't have space to park them, keep it in any warehouse where it will not only be kept safely, but also get home-like treatment.
*A Weather-Resistant Storage: What if you are planning to store wooden furniture to protect it from moisture and dust. Keep them in a weather-resistant storage unit that is constantly insulated to maintain temperature stability. These units are also free from pests.
*Movable Storage: Moving self storage facility refers to a service that is always on the move. It picks goods from the doorsteps of the customer and drops them back. This facility is often used by frequent travelers.
*Mini Storage: If you don't have much to store but still need storage for small goods, such as artifacts, your childhood album, or important documents, you can opt for a mini storage. Almost all warehouses offer locker facility to their customers as mini storage.
